Adaptive AI

Can someone explain how adaptive AI works specifically in R3E? I'm trying to figure out "when" the AI adapts to my abilities. Is it during each session? Or race to race? Or what?

I don't think its over an event weekend since I absolutely crushed the AI in practice, qualifying, and race. I hope the game takes my abilities from all modes into account and adjust accordingly...even if I just do a practice or single race.

I find the adaptive AI does not work. I have tried to do a championship using the AAI but it doesn't seem to get any better. I have read that you need to do many full race weekends to get it to work. I gave up and just set my AI at 104 and it gives me great races. Hope this helps.:thumbsup:
 
Thanks for the reply Andy. I'll try to setup the AI over the next few races. I did find an interesting discussion about it over on the R3E Steam forums:

http://steamcommunity.com/app/211500/discussions/1/540744934756588760/.

From that discussion, it soundslike the adaptive AI is track specific, so the best way to setup the AI would be to play the same track 3-5 times then move to the next track. Once you've raced on all the tracks 3-5 times each, the AI should be more "adpative" to your skill.
 
That's how I understand it too. tbh I never have the time to gun the same track and cars several times to get it up to speed, so as Andy above says, I just throw it up with 107% AI and have a good race mid pack.
The problem with adaptive for me is I much prefer to be midfield and have a good race trying to keep up, with adaptive once its tuned its supposed to give you a good race at or near the front.
